โฆ Synopsis
We will be concerned with the focal boundary value problem (-1)'~An[p(t)Any (h,t,y(t) ..... An-ls/(t)), Ail/(0) = A'~+ill(b+ 1) ----0, 0 _< i _< n --1. Using cone theory in a Bausch space, we show that under certain Bumptioas on f, this focal boundary value problem has two positive solutions. In the special case --A21/(t-1) ----h2[ya(t) +I/B(t)], g/(0) --Ay(b+ 1) ----0, where 0 < ยข~ < 1 < fl, we are able to exhibit upper and lower bounds for thee two pceitive solutions.
